Please be aware of new AIS requirements in Utah

Dan Keller

UT DWR Fish Biologist
I know this has been discussed before, however as a reminder, ALL boaters using Utah waters, whether a Utah resident or nonresident, must take the annual Utah mussel-aware boater course and have proof of course completion in your launch vehicle (a printed copy or downloaded to your DWR Hunting and Fishing mobile app). This includes users of all kinds of watercraft, including motorized boats and human-powered kayaks, canoes, paddleboards, etc.

Boaters with motorized watercraft must also enroll in the Utah AIS Program and pay an annual fee — $20 for Utah residents and $25 for nonresidents — through the Utah Division of Wildlife Resources.

Visit Utah's AIS Webpage for more details. Thank you for your compliance and helping spread the word, we don't want anyone to be caught unaware of this change when visiting Lake Powell or other Utah water bodies.
